There are 20 nursing homes near Otis Orchards, Washington. The mean daily cost of nursing home care in Washington is around $253, with costs running between $100 and $362 per day. On a per month basis, this equates to a median cost of $7,590, with costs ranging from around $3,000 to $10,860. The mean annual cost is $92,345, which is higher than the nationwide average of $77,380.
Costs for nursing home care in Otis Orchards, WA typically range between $270 per day and $394 per day. The median cost is about $298 per day, or around $108,770 per year.
